At this point I was quite achy from carrying this monster around for all my paintings, so I decided to try and figure out a tiny tiny watercolour setup I could easily take on walks, and I've done SO many paintings since. It takes some of the pressure off, I can go on a walk with my mini kit, and if I don't paint there's no harm done. I have a tiny bit of card cut from a planner, some sewing clips, and a bulldog clip to balance the pad on (I still rest it on my fingers, but it contains the movement a bit more) I also use a water brush, and a bit of tissue paper tucked into my fanny pack (...bum bag), and that's it!

I use loose binder rings so I can open them up and add pages, I was originally tying in loose pages but it wasn't secure, so I figured I'd replace the spiral binding with rings. The sketchbook was originally a daler rowney ebony! I did have to stick an elastic loop to the back that I wrap round it when it's not in use, because the rings mean the pages move/rub together more!
